### Step 4: Migrate the fuel-usage report

Almost there. FleetGauge's fuel-usage report moves from the old nightly cron to the new on-demand worker in this release. Before you flip the switch, drain any queued report jobs — Marta's script in the tools repo handles that in about ten minutes. Once the queue shows empty, deploy the worker build and re-run one sample report for the Dunmore depot to sanity-check the numbers. The worker reads its settings at boot, so double-check them first. Here is the full set of configuration values it expects.

service settings:
PRAIX_LOG_LEVEL=error
PRAIX_METRICS_HOST=metrics.praix.qorvelcorp.corp
PRAIX_POOL_SIZE=16

Handover Note — Gross-Margin Review

To the heads of department: I am passing the Verdane Instruments margin review to Director Halloway at quarter-end. The workbook reconciles landed costs for the Corvid line against the Maplestead plant's revised overhead allocations; please verify your department's inputs before sign-off. Two anomalies remain open — freight reclassification on the Aldery route and the rework provision for batch tooling. Halloway will convene a closing session in the second week. The confidential planning note follows below.

board note of kageg-bahof: The renewal with Holwynax Holdings closes at $2 million a year, 5 percent below the last contract. Project Ulaath slips by two quarters because of the supplier delay.

**FAQ: Order Cutoff Logic — CrumbGate**

Q: Why does CrumbGate reject orders after 14:00 local?

A: The Ovenbrook bakery needs proofing lead time. Cutoff is enforced server-side in the order validator; client-side checks are advisory only. Timezone comes from the store record, not the browser. Don't approve PRs that move cutoff logic client-side. Overrides require manager unlock in the admin console, which prompts for the stored recovery credential. For review access to that console, use the passphrase that follows.

unlock words, tagaf-hahif: ralwyn-lammir-rusax-sormir